No. 114 -4) <br />Program Type <br />New <br />Program Overview, Objectives, and Priorities <br />Overview <br />The purpose of the Emergency Management Performance Grant (EMPG) Program is to <br />provide Federal funds to states to assist state, local, territorial, and tribal governments in <br />preparing for all hazards, as authorized by Section 662 of the Post Katrina Emergency <br />Management Reform Act (6 U.S.C. § 762) and the Robert T. Stafford Disaster Relief and <br />Emergency Assistance Act (42 U.S.C. §§ 5121 gt M.). Title VI of the Stafford Act <br />authorizes FEMA to make grants for the purpose of providing a system of emergency <br />preparedness for the protection of life and property in the United States from hazards and <br />to vest responsibility for emergency preparedness jointly in the Federal Government, <br />states, and their political subdivisions. The Federal Government, through the EMPG <br />Program, provides necessary direction, coordination, and guidance, and provides <br />necessary assistance, as authorized in this title, to support a comprehensive all hazards <br />emergency preparedness system. The FY 2015 EMPG will provide Federal funds to <br />assist state, local, tribal, and territorial emergency management agencies to obtain the <br />resources required to support the National Preparedness Goal's (the Goal's) associated <br />mission areas and core capabilities.
